Output 81e8908a38bb51e00948f713fadc08e03835d0a3ca3e97098f59ceee83469c44:501

value
1024230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 195f93d117c087046cc9771184695454a79f860c OP_EQUAL
address
341BKB4hhDuU9RT9YDoi5FVd8VxcBCqpGR
transaction
81e8908a38bb51e00948f713fadc08e03835d0a3ca3e97098f59ceee83469c44
confirmations
304063
spent
true